The fresh new pandemic forbearance to possess government student loans is has just prolonged for a 6th date-establishing a historic thirty-month stop towards the federal education loan costs. The original post within this series spends survey investigation to assist united states discover hence individuals will likely challenge in the event the pandemic forbearance finishes. The results from this survey plus the exposure to specific federal consumers which don’t discover forbearance inside pandemic suggest that delinquencies you can expect to go beyond pre-pandemic profile just after forbearance comes to an end. This type of issues has revived discussions along the chances of blanket forgiveness regarding government figuratively speaking. Calls for student loan forgiveness joined brand new popular within the 2020 election with a lot of proposals centering as much as blanket federal student loan forgiveness (normally $10,100000 or $50,000) otherwise financing forgiveness having certain money limitations to possess qualifications. Numerous degree (instances right here, here, that’s where) enjoys tried to assess the expenses and distribution off great things about any of these formula. In this article, i have fun with member study from anonymized credit file that allows us to determine government funds, assess the full price of these proposals, explore crucial heterogeneity within the which owes government student loans, and check that would more than likely benefit from federal student loan forgiveness.
